Every weekend of the Star Wars Weekends, Disney casts a limited edition collectible coin in a variety of metals.
Last year the image was of Jedi Mickey back-to-back with Yoda, both with lightsaber drawn and ready to defend the Force from the agents of the dark side.
This year to coincide with the DVD release, the Disney image is Mickey Mouse and Minnie Mouse in the classic Luke and Leia pose on the original Star Wars A New Hope theater poster.
The first week's coin was bronze, then came Nickel Silver, 24k gold overlay, and finally .999 fine silver. The bronze and nickel coins retailed at $15.00 each, and the latter two retailed at $20.00 at the park. eBay prices for the coins started at $50-$65 a piece, but finally settled around $35-$40 each.
